MRSTP Commands

Use these commands to configure MRSTP on the Switch.

39.1 MRSTP Overview

The Switch allows you to configure multiple instances of Rapid Spanning Tree Protocol
(RSTP) as defined in the following standard.

• IEEE 802.1w Rapid Spanning Tree Protocol

39.2 Command Summary

The following section lists the commands for this feature.

Table 89 Command Summary: mrstp

COMMAND

DESCRIPTION

M

P

show mrstp <tree-index>

Displays multiple rapid spanning tree configuration

for the specified tree.
tree-index: this is a number identifying the RSTP

tree configuration.

spanning-tree mode

Specifies the STP mode you want to implement on

the Switch.

mrstp <tree-index>

Activates the specified RSTP configuration.

mrstp <tree-index> priority <0-61440>

Sets the bridge priority of the Switch for the specified

RSTP configuration.

mrstp <tree-index> hello-time <1-10>
maximum-age <6-40> forward-delay <4-
30>

Sets the Hello Time, Maximum Age and Forward

Delay values on the Switch for the specified RSTP

configuration.

mrstp interface <port-list>

Activates RSTP on the specified ports.

mrstp interface <port-list> path-cost
<1-65535>

Sets a path cost to the specified ports.
